Fawn Trapped In Fence Rescued By Prince George's Firefighters
A fawn trapped in a wrought iron fence was rescued Friday by Prince George's firefighters and reunited with her mom.

PRINCE GEORGE'S COUNTY, MD — Firefighters from Station 842 in Oxon Hill helped rescue a fawn who was trapped in a wrought iron fence near their fire station Friday.
Firefighters were able to calm the baby, who was uninjured, and set it free. The fawn scampered off to its momma, who was watching the action closely from the nearby woods.
